Chelsea Eye A Swoop For £27million Defensive Ace: Is He Worth The Fuss?

Chelsea are reportedly eyeing a transfer for AS Roma centre-back Gianluca Mancini this summer. 

According to the Express, Chelsea will compete with Manchester United for Mancini. Roma though are not too keen to sell the talented centre-back, who they see as a long-term prospect.

However, every player has a price, and the financial implications of COVID-19 could force the club to cash in on the defender.

As per reports, the 24-year-old Roma centre-back could be available for a fee of £27 million in the summer. Mancini’s contract expires in 2024.

He might plan to review his options in the summer. And, if Roma fail to secure Champions League football, they might find it hard to retain Mancini.

Gianluca Mancini  –  Is he worth the fuss?

Under Thomas Tuchel, Chelsea have become a lot more sturdy unit, and are yet to lose since the German took over. However, there is more room for improvement. Last season, the Blues reinforced their defence by signing Thiago Silva on a free transfer.

Since his arrival at Stamford Bridge, the Brazilian has made a big impression. But at 36, he is nearing the end of his career. So, he needs to be replaced with a younger and an able prospect.

Throughout this season, Mancini has only lost three Serie A games, playing 23 times for Roma. He has scored five goals too, and is one of the best defenders in the Serie A at the moment.

Mancini is a tall, physically intimidating central defender who can play in both a three and a four-man defence. His outstanding heading ability is one of his strongest attributes, allowing him a pose a goal threat in the opposition’s penalty box as well.

His distribution is pretty impressive as well, as he has recorded a pass accuracy of 89.5% and is good with his passing.

The aforementioned attributes are perfect for Tuchel’s gameplan and tactic, and would add more quality and depth to the Chelsea defence.

It will be also a bonus for Chelsea to sign the 24-year-old at the mentioned price. We have seen centre-backs’ price being skyrocket in recent windows, so £27 million would be a bargain for a player of Mancini’s potential.
